summaryrefslogtreecommitdiffstats
path: root/src/com/android/launcher3/compat
diff options
context:
space:
mode:
Diffstat (limited to 'src/com/android/launcher3/compat')
-rw-r--r--src/com/android/launcher3/compat/AppWidgetManagerCompat.java2
-rw-r--r--src/com/android/launcher3/compat/LauncherAppsCompat.java2
-rw-r--r--src/com/android/launcher3/compat/WallpaperManagerCompat.java4
-rw-r--r--src/com/android/launcher3/compat/WallpaperManagerCompatVOMR1.java3
4 files changed, 6 insertions, 5 deletions
diff --git a/src/com/android/launcher3/compat/AppWidgetManagerCompat.java b/src/com/android/launcher3/compat/AppWidgetManagerCompat.java
index 4e00eae9d..a77a87f2c 100644
--- a/src/com/android/launcher3/compat/AppWidgetManagerCompat.java
+++ b/src/com/android/launcher3/compat/AppWidgetManagerCompat.java
@@ -40,7 +40,7 @@ public abstract class AppWidgetManagerCompat {
public static AppWidgetManagerCompat getInstance(Context context) {
synchronized (sInstanceLock) {
if (sInstance == null) {
- if (Utilities.isAtLeastO()) {
+ if (Utilities.ATLEAST_OREO) {
sInstance = new AppWidgetManagerCompatVO(context.getApplicationContext());
} else {
sInstance = new AppWidgetManagerCompatVL(context.getApplicationContext());
diff --git a/src/com/android/launcher3/compat/LauncherAppsCompat.java b/src/com/android/launcher3/compat/LauncherAppsCompat.java
index 75a2a5d18..2cac536f6 100644
--- a/src/com/android/launcher3/compat/LauncherAppsCompat.java
+++ b/src/com/android/launcher3/compat/LauncherAppsCompat.java
@@ -53,7 +53,7 @@ public abstract class LauncherAppsCompat {
public static LauncherAppsCompat getInstance(Context context) {
synchronized (sInstanceLock) {
if (sInstance == null) {
- if (Utilities.isAtLeastO()) {
+ if (Utilities.ATLEAST_OREO) {
sInstance = new LauncherAppsCompatVO(context.getApplicationContext());
} else {
sInstance = new LauncherAppsCompatVL(context.getApplicationContext());
diff --git a/src/com/android/launcher3/compat/WallpaperManagerCompat.java b/src/com/android/launcher3/compat/WallpaperManagerCompat.java
index cbcabdf9b..00258c7da 100644
--- a/src/com/android/launcher3/compat/WallpaperManagerCompat.java
+++ b/src/com/android/launcher3/compat/WallpaperManagerCompat.java
@@ -31,10 +31,10 @@ public abstract class WallpaperManagerCompat {
if (sInstance == null) {
context = context.getApplicationContext();
- if (Utilities.isAtLeastO()) {
+ if (Utilities.ATLEAST_OREO) {
try {
sInstance = new WallpaperManagerCompatVOMR1(context);
- } catch (Exception e) {
+ } catch (Throwable e) {
// The wallpaper APIs do not yet exist
}
}
diff --git a/src/com/android/launcher3/compat/WallpaperManagerCompatVOMR1.java b/src/com/android/launcher3/compat/WallpaperManagerCompatVOMR1.java
index 28b780a38..524f266fc 100644
--- a/src/com/android/launcher3/compat/WallpaperManagerCompatVOMR1.java
+++ b/src/com/android/launcher3/compat/WallpaperManagerCompatVOMR1.java
@@ -35,8 +35,9 @@ public class WallpaperManagerCompatVOMR1 extends WallpaperManagerCompat {
private final WallpaperManager mWm;
private Method mWCColorHintsMethod;
- WallpaperManagerCompatVOMR1(Context context) throws Exception {
+ WallpaperManagerCompatVOMR1(Context context) throws Throwable {
mWm = context.getSystemService(WallpaperManager.class);
+ String className = WallpaperColors.class.getName();
try {
mWCColorHintsMethod = WallpaperColors.class.getDeclaredMethod("getColorHints");
} catch (Exception exc) {